Diabetes support groups in Western Australia
A diabetes support group is a group of people with diabetes, who regularly get together to share information, experiences and knowledge. Some groups provide online support.
Group members support each other and work together to improve each other’s quality of life.
In most instances, the support groups are led by individuals living with diabetes rather than diabetes educators or other health professionals. Being part of a support group and receiving advice is complementary to professional care.
Type 1 diabetes support groups
The Type 1 Diabetes Family Centre in Stirling connects, supports and inspires people of all ages with type 1 diabetes and the people who care about them. It offers information workshops, education programs, online communities, schools and babysitter education, camps, advocacy and a dynamic calendar of social and community events.
